Seared shrimp over mashed peas

Temps total: 30 min • Préparation: 15 min • Cuisson: 15 min • Portions: 4 • Difficulté: Facile

This quick and easy meal feels elevated and can jazz up a busy weeknight. If you have shrimp and peas stashed in your freezer, you’re most of the way there. We love the flavour of mint with the peas, but you can omit it or substitute parsley if you prefer.

Ingrédients

Cooking spray

4 spray(s)

Frozen baby peas

1½ pound(s)

Salted butter

1 tbsp(s)

Kosher salt

¾ tsp(s), divided

Black pepper

½ tsp(s), divided

Uncooked shrimp

1 pound(s), large, peeled and deveined

Sugar

1 tsp(s)

Garlic powder

1 tsp(s)

Olive oil

1 tsp(s)

Fresh mint leaves

1 tbsp(s), finely chopped, plus more for garnish if desired

Lemon zest

1½ tsp(s), divided

Lemon

4 wedge(s)

Instructions

1

In a medium saucepan over medium-high, combine ¼ cup water, peas, butter, ½ tsp salt, and ¼ tsp black pepper; bring the water to a boil. Cover and cook on medium-low until peas are very tender, 12 to 15 minutes.

2

Meanwhile, in a medium bowl, combine the shrimp, sugar, garlic powder, oil, and remaining ¼ tsp each salt and black pepper. Coat a large nonstick skillet with cooking spray and heat over medium-high. Add the shrimp in a single layer; cook until seared and cooked through, 1 ½ to 2 minutes per side.

3

Mash the peas with a potato masher to your desired consistency; stir in the mint and ½ tsp lemon zest. Divide the pea mixture evenly among 4 plates; top evenly with the shrimp. Garnish with the remaining 1 tsp lemon zest and additional mint, if desired. Serve with lemon wedges.

4

Serving size: about ⅔ cup pea mixture and 4 ounces shrimp
